§ 2111 — Payments for vocational rehabilitation

(a)The Division is the authorized agency for vocational rehabilitation of a person with blindness or a person with visual impairment. The Division may pay for training, maintenance, or physical restoration of a person with blindness or a person with visual impairment, and whom the Division finds is eligible for vocational rehabilitation.
(b)On receiving an appropriate voucher, the State Treasurer shall make a payment authorized under this section.
